DVD ID: MIMA-018
Content ID: mima00018
Release Date: 17 May 2025
Duration: 123 mins
Director: JEDI JEDI
Studio: Milu
Categories: Exclusive Distribution Leotards Featured Actress Cosplay Non-nude Erotica Big Tits
Cast(s): Shiori Hamabe